Subject: Key rotation — Chattervane sampling pipeline

As part of this quarter's credential hygiene review, we are rotating the key used by the log-sampling sidecar for the Chattervane service. The old key remains valid for 48 hours to allow a staged rollout; after that, unsampled firehose writes will be rejected. The new key for the internal sampler endpoint follows below.

gateway credential: kto3_qfe

Effective next quarter, Bramhall Systems moves from flat-rate commissions to a tiered model. Deals under the base threshold pay 4%; mid-tier deals pay 6%; strategic accounts pay 8% plus a renewal bonus. Accelerators apply once a rep exceeds 110% of quota. Draws are discontinued for tenured staff. Heads of department should brief their teams on mechanics only, not rationale. Payout timing shifts to monthly reconciliation under the Ledgerline tool. The rationale ties directly to the confidential plan noted below.

board note of kawig-tawif: Project Julmir slips by two quarters because of the supplier delay.

Key Ceremony Checklist — Vellidor Elevator-Dispatch Simulator, step 7

Confirm both custodians present. Verify the simulator's signing HSM shows ceremony mode. Load the dispatch-model release candidate, record the checksum in the ledger, and seal the witness envelope. Before the HSM will export the release signature, it prompts for the ceremony recovery passphrase. Read it aloud for the witness, then enter it exactly as written below.

unlock words, hahap-yawig: pelix-kelion-tamys-jorix-julok

Ticket: Missed pick-up — antique clock repair consignment

For the records team: the scheduled collection of the Aldermoor longcase clock, due to be transported to Fennick & Rowe Horology for repair, was missed on Monday. The courier, Larchway Carriers, cited a routing error. The clock remains crated in the archive annexe with its condition report attached. Collection has been rebooked for Wednesday afternoon. Please note the rescheduling in the asset log, and ensure the arriving driver receives the hand-over instruction below.

drop instructions, yafog-yawip: the quenmir olidor courier leaves the julox tamion keliel ledger at gate 5283 under passcode 336825